Output dd3aeda5948fb31aff16580a2897b25ac7b2bbb238fa886ca8c690df8991f102:821

value
244289
script pubkey
OP_0 OP_PUSHBYTES_20 4ea0bf7d68d5acdb5264def0cb8119513415572f
address
ltc1qf6st7ltg6kkdk5nymmcvhqge2y6p24e0uvtvfe
transaction
dd3aeda5948fb31aff16580a2897b25ac7b2bbb238fa886ca8c690df8991f102
spent
false